What is the difference between Deputy Cto vs Technical Project Manager?

AspectDeputy CtoTechnical Project Manager
CredentialsTypically requires a degree in computer science or related field, with experience in leadership rolesUsually holds a degree in IT, computer science, or engineering, with project management certifications like PMP
Work EnvironmentExecutive-level, strategic planning, overseeing technology departmentsProject-focused, managing specific technical projects and teams
Industry UsageCommon in tech companies, startups, and large organizations with CTO structuresWidely used across industries for managing technical projects

The Deputy Cto supports the CTO in strategic leadership and decision-making, often stepping in for the CTO when needed. In contrast, a Technical Project Manager focuses on planning, executing, and closing specific technical projects. While both roles require technical knowledge, the Deputy Cto has a broader leadership scope, whereas the Technical Project Manager concentrates on project delivery.

What does a deputy CTO do?

A deputy CTO supports the Chief Technology Officer by overseeing technology strategies, managing technical teams, and ensuring project delivery. They often handle day-to-day operations, implement technical solutions, and may step in for the CTO when needed, requiring strong leadership and technical expertise. The role typically involves collaboration with other executive leaders and familiarity with industry-standard tools and methodologies.

How does a Deputy CTO typically support cross-functional collaboration within a technology organization?

A Deputy CTO plays a vital role in fostering collaboration between engineering, product, and business teams. They often facilitate communication by translating technical concepts for non-technical stakeholders and ensuring alignment on project goals and timelines. Deputy CTOs also help resolve interdepartmental challenges and coordinate resources to keep projects on track. This collaborative approach not only streamlines workflows but also promotes innovation and shared ownership of outcomes across the organization.

What are Deputy CTOs?

Deputy Chief Technology Officers (Deputy CTOs) are senior technology leaders who assist the Chief Technology Officer in overseeing a company's technological direction, initiatives, and teams. They play a key role in strategic planning, technology implementation, and ensuring that IT systems align with business goals. Deputy CTOs often manage day-to-day operations, mentor technical staff, and help shape the organization's technology roadmap. Their responsibilities may also include evaluating new technologies, managing budgets, and acting as a bridge between executives and technical teams.

Position Overview

The Deputy Chief Technology Officer (Deputy CTO), Infrastructure & Security Engineering, serves as the principal deputy to the CTO. This executive position combines deep technical expertise with leadership responsibility across cloud infrastructure, advanced networking, and security engineering.

This role is accountable for ensuring that all technology platformsโ€”including multi-account and multi-tenant cloud environments, network interconnectivity, shared services, and security frameworksโ€”are designed, operated, and continuously improved to meet organizational goals for performance, reliability, security, compliance, and cost efficiency. The Deputy CTO frequently represents the CTO in executive discussions, customer engagements, and during high-priority incidents.

This position requires an on-site presence three days per week at the Phoenix office.

Key Responsibilities

Leadership & Strategic Direction

  • Serve as the CTOโ€™s primary proxy for executive decision-making, leadership forums, and client-facing technical discussions.
  • Translate product vision and technology roadmaps into actionable infrastructure, networking, and security strategies with clear, measurable results.
  • Define and maintain technical standards, architectural patterns, and operational frameworks used across engineering teams.
  • Coach and develop leadership across infrastructure, platform, networking, and security disciplines.

Infrastructure & Networking

  • Oversee the design and operation of cloud networking environments (e.g., multi-VPC architectures, transit gateways, multi-region deployments).
  • Lead hybrid connectivity solutions, including VPNs, routing protocols, DNS, and load balancing across distributed systems.
  • Implement robust network segmentation and enforce least-privilege access models across tenants and environments.
  • Drive infrastructure automation through Infrastructure as Code (e.g., Terraform) to ensure consistency and scalability.
  • Guide capacity planning, performance tuning, and reliability improvements for shared systems and services.

Security Engineering

  • Design and enforce comprehensive security controls across networks and platforms, including Zero Trust principles and threat protection mechanisms.
  • Establish hardening standards across operating systems, containers, and network components, and ensure timely vulnerability remediation.
  • Align engineering practices with compliance frameworks such as CJIS, StateRAMP, FedRAMP, and SOC 2 in partnership with GRC teams.
  • Lead incident response efforts related to infrastructure and networking, including root cause analysis and remediation planning.
  • Oversee identity-driven access and federation solutions (e.g., SSO/MFA integrations) across internal and customer-facing systems.

Operations & Reliability

  • Implement SRE best practices, including observability, service level objectives, alerting, and operational runbooks.
  • Ensure high availability and disaster recovery capabilities meet defined RPO/RTO targets.
  • Standardize CI/CD pipelines for infrastructure and platform delivery with secure, auditable change processes.
  • Coordinate cross-functional readiness for major releases, migrations, and customer launches.

Cost Optimization & Vendor Management

  • Own budgets for infrastructure, networking, and security; drive cost optimization initiatives.
  • Manage relationships with key vendors and service providers, including contract negotiation and performance oversight.

Compliance & Audit Support

  • Ensure audit readiness by maintaining continuous documentation and evidence of engineering controls and processes.
  • Support customer due diligence and security reviews by clearly articulating architecture and safeguards.

Team Leadership & Development

  • Foster a culture of accountability, continuous learning, and operational excellence.
  • Define organizational structure, staffing strategies, and career development paths across engineering teams.

Qualifications & Experience

  • 10+ years of progressive experience in technology leadership, with at least 7 years managing large-scale cloud infrastructure and networking environments.
  • Demonstrated expertise in designing and operating complex, distributed cloud architectures and hybrid connectivity solutions.
  • Proven track record in leading security engineering initiatives and managing incident response.

Technical Expertise

  • Strong background in cloud platforms and networking, including AWS services, routing, and connectivity design.
  • Experience with edge security, web application protection, encryption standards, and certificate management.
  • Knowledge of enterprise firewall technologies and network segmentation strategies.
  • Proficiency in automation tools (e.g., Terraform), version control workflows, and policy enforcement frameworks.
  • Familiarity with observability platforms, SIEM/SOAR tools, and performance monitoring systems.
  • Experience with CI/CD tools, container orchestration, and platform engineering practices.
  • Working knowledge of operating systems, databases, and scripting languages.

Education & Certifications

  • Bachelorโ€™s degree in Computer Science, Information Systems, or a related field (Masterโ€™s preferred).
  • Relevant certifications such as CISSP, CISM, CCSP, CCNP (or equivalent), and AWS specialty certifications are strongly preferred.

Core Competencies

  • Strong executive communication and ability to engage effectively with customers and auditors.
  • Sound decision-making under pressure with a strong sense of ownership and accountability.
  • Ability to operate at both strategic and hands-on technical levels as needed.

Performance Indicators (Examples)

  • Achievement of uptime and service-level objectives across critical systems.
  • Improvements in incident detection and resolution times.
  • Adoption of Infrastructure as Code and reduction in configuration drift.
  • Efficiency in environment provisioning and deployment success rates.
  • Optimization of infrastructure costs relative to usage.
  • Audit readiness and successful compliance outcomes.
  • Timely remediation of high-risk vulnerabilities.

Reporting Structure

This role reports directly to the Chief Technology Officer and collaborates closely with Product, Engineering, Architecture, Program Management, and Security/GRC teams.
